The Art and Science of Mobile App Development: A Comprehensive Guide

In today’s digital age, where smartphones have become an extension of our daily lives, mobile applications have emerged as indispensable tools for businesses and individuals alike. Whether it’s enhancing productivity, connecting with customers, or simply providing entertainment, the demand for innovative mobile apps continues to soar. However, behind every successful mobile app lies a meticulous development process that combines creativity, technical expertise, and user-centric design. In this guide, we’ll delve into the intricacies of mobile app development, exploring the key steps involved, best practices, and emerging trends shaping the industry.

1. Ideation and Conceptualization:
Every successful mobile app begins with a solid idea. Whether it’s addressing a specific need, solving a problem, or capitalizing on a market opportunity, the ideation phase sets the foundation for the entire development process. During this stage, developers collaborate with stakeholders to brainstorm ideas, conduct market research, and define the app’s core objectives and target audience. By identifying key features, functionalities, and monetization strategies early on, developers can ensure alignment with business goals and user expectations.

2. Prototyping and Design:
Once the concept is fleshed out, the next step is to create a prototype that translates ideas into tangible visuals and interactions. Prototyping tools allow developers to sketch wireframes, create mockups, and design user interfaces that prioritize usability and accessibility. User experience (UX) design plays a crucial role in this phase, as developers strive to deliver intuitive navigation, seamless interactions, and visually appealing layouts. By soliciting feedback from stakeholders and conducting usability testing, developers can refine the prototype iteratively, ensuring a user-centric design that resonates with the target audience.

3. Development and Testing:
With the prototype finalized, developers proceed to the development phase, where they bring the app to life through coding and programming. The choice of development framework and technology stack depends on various factors, including the app’s complexity, platform compatibility, and performance requirements. Whether opting for native, hybrid, or cross-platform development, developers prioritize writing clean, efficient code that adheres to industry standards and best practices. Throughout the development process, rigorous testing is conducted to identify and address bugs, compatibility issues, and performance bottlenecks. Automated testing tools, manual QA testing, and beta testing with real users help ensure a seamless, bug-free user experience across different devices and operating systems.

4. Deployment and Distribution:
Once the app is developed and thoroughly tested, it’s ready for deployment to the respective app stores (e.g., Apple App Store, Google Play Store). Developers must adhere to each platform’s guidelines and submission requirements, including app store optimization (ASO) techniques to maximize visibility and downloads. Upon approval, the app becomes available for download to users worldwide, marking the culmination of the development journey.

5. Maintenance and Optimization:
However, mobile app development doesn’t end with deployment; it’s an ongoing process that requires continuous maintenance and optimization. Developers monitor user feedback, analyze app performance metrics, and iterate based on evolving user needs and technological advancements. Regular updates, feature enhancements, and bug fixes ensure that the app remains relevant, competitive, and aligned with industry standards. Moreover, optimization techniques such as A/B testing, performance tuning, and security patches help enhance user satisfaction, retention, and overall app success.

6. Emerging Trends and Future Outlook:
As technology continues to evolve, the landscape of mobile app development is constantly evolving. From the rise of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) to the adoption of aug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R), developers are leveraging cutting-edge technologies to create immersive, personalized app experiences. Moreover, the growing prevalence of Internet of Things (IoT) devices and wearables presents new opportunities for app integration and innovation. By staying abreast of emerging trends and embracing a culture of continuous learning and adaptation, developers can stay ahead of the curve and deliver groundbreaking mobile apps that captivate and delight users.

In conclusion, mobile app development is a multifaceted process that blends creativity, technical expertise, and user-centric design principles. By following a systematic approach encompassing ideation, prototyping, development, testing, deployment, and maintenance, developers can create high-quality mobile apps that resonate with users and drive business success in an increasingly mobile-centric world. As technology continues to evolve and user expectations evolve, embracing innovation and staying adaptable will be key to staying ahead in the dynamic field of mobile app development.

 The Evolution of Email: From Letters to the Inbox

In the fast-paced digital age, where instant messaging and social media dominate our communication landscape, it’s easy to overlook the humble yet powerful tool that has withstood the test of time: email. Since its inception, email has revolutionized the way we communicate, transforming the world of personal and professional correspondence. Let’s take a journey through the evolution of email, from its modest beginnings to its indispensable role in our daily lives.

1. The Birth of Email:
Email, short for electronic mail, traces its origins back to the 1960s and 1970s when researchers and programmers sought ways to exchange messages over computer networks. The first email system, known as MAILBOX, was developed by Ray Tomlinson in 1971, allowing users to send messages between different machines on the ARPANET, the precursor to the internet.

2. From Text-Based to Multimedia:
In its early days, email was primarily text-based, limited to plain ASCII characters. However, as technology advanced, so did the capabilities of email. The introduction of HTML formatting allowed users to create visually appealing messages with fonts, colors, and images. Multimedia elements such as attachments enabled users to share documents, photos, and videos seamlessly.

3. The Rise of Webmail:
The advent of webmail services like Hotmail, Yahoo! Mail, and Gmail in the late 1990s and early 2000s revolutionized email accessibility. No longer tied to specific email clients or devices, users could access their messages from any web browser, ushering in a new era of convenience and flexibility.

4. Mobile Email:
With the proliferation of smartphones, email became even more pervasive, with users checking their inboxes on the go. Mobile email apps offered optimized experiences for smaller screens, making it easier to manage emails, respond promptly, and stay organized while away from the desktop.

5. Email Marketing and Spam:
As email usage soared, so did unsolicited messages and spam. Marketers recognized the potential of email as a powerful marketing tool, leading to the rise of email marketing campaigns. However, this also led to concerns about privacy, security, and inbox clutter, prompting the development of anti-spam measures and email filtering technologies.

6. The Future of Email:
Despite the emergence of alternative communication platforms, email remains a cornerstone of modern communication. Innovations such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and blockchain are poised to further enhance email capabilities, offering intelligent email sorting, enhanced security, and decentralized communication protocols.

Conclusion:
From its humble beginnings as a tool for computer scientists to its widespread adoption as a global communication medium, email has come a long way. Its adaptability, ubiquity, and enduring relevance make it a vital component of both personal and professional communication. As we look to the future, email will continue to evolve, ensuring that it remains an essential tool for connecting people across the globe.

In a world where trends come and go, email stands as a testament to the enduring power of digital communication. So, the next time you hit send on that email, take a moment to appreciate the remarkable journey that this simple yet transformative technology has undertaken.

How to set-up Scrcpy for mirroring phone on Windows PC.

Setting up Scrcpy for mirroring your Android phone on a Windows PC is a straightforward process. Scrcpy is an open-source application that allows you to display and control Android devices connected via USB or wirelessly.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you set it up:

Prerequisites:

  1. Enable USB Debugging on your Android device. To do this:
    • Go to Settings > About Phone.
    • Tap on “Build Number” multiple times until it says you are now a developer.
    • Go back to Settings, find “Developer Options,” and enable USB debugging.
  2. Install ADB Drivers on your Windows PC. ADB (Android Debug Bridge) is a command-line tool that facilitates communication between your Android device and PC.
    • You can download the ADB installer from the official Android Developer website: ADB Installer.
    • Follow the installation instructions provided with the installer.

Installing Scrcpy:

  1. Download Scrcpy:
    • Visit the official GitHub repository for Scrcpy: Scrcpy Releases.
    • Download the latest version of Scrcpy for Windows (scrcpy-win64-vX.XX.zip).
  2. Extract Scrcpy:
    • Once the download is complete, extract the contents of the downloaded zip file to a folder on your PC (e.g., C:\scrcpy).
  3. Connect Your Android Device:
    • Use a USB cable to connect your Android device to your PC.
  4. Allow USB Debugging:
    • If prompted on your Android device, allow USB debugging access to your PC.
  5. Launch Scrcpy:
    • Navigate to the folder where you extracted Scrcpy.
    • Double-click on scrcpy.exe to launch the application.
  6. Mirror Your Phone:
    • Once Scrcpy is launched, you should see your Android device’s screen mirrored on your PC.

Additional Notes:

  • Scrcpy also supports wireless connection, but initially, you need to connect via USB to set it up.
  • You can adjust various settings such as resolution, bitrate, and more using command-line options. Refer to the Scrcpy documentation for more details.

Conclusion:

By following these steps, you should be able to set up Scrcpy on your Windows PC and mirror your Android device’s screen effortlessly. Remember to keep both Scrcpy and ADB updated for the best experience.

PROJECT IDEAS FOR FINAL YEAR IT STUDENTS

Here are some project ideas for final year IT students:

1. E-commerce Platform:Develop a comprehensive e-commerce platform that includes features such as user authentication, product listings, shopping cart functionality, payment integration, and order management. You can also incorporate advanced features like recommendation systems, user reviews, and inventory management.

2. Online Learning Management System:Create an online learning management system (LMS) for educational institutions or corporate training programs. Include features for course creation, content management, student enrollment, assessments, progress tracking, and discussion forums.

3. Healthcare Management System: Design a healthcare management system to streamline administrative tasks, patient records management, appointment scheduling, billing, and telemedicine consultations. Ensure compliance with healthcare regulations such as H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act) for data security and privacy.

4. Smart Home Automation System:Build a smart home automation system that allows users to control various devices and appliances remotely using a mobile app or web interface. Integrate features like voice commands, scheduling, energy monitoring, and security alerts for enhanced convenience and efficiency.

5. Blockchain-Based Application:Explore blockchain technology by developing an application for secure transactions, supply chain management, digital identity verification, or decentralized voting systems. Experiment with different blockchain platforms like Ethereum, Hyperledger, or Corda.

6. Internet of Things (IoT) Project:Create an IoT project that connects physical devices to the internet and enables data collection, monitoring, and control. Examples include smart sensors for environmental monitoring, home automation systems, wearable health devices, or industrial IoT solutions.

7. Data Analytics Platform:Develop a data analytics platform for processing, analyzing, and visualizing large datasets. Include features for data ingestion, storage, querying, machine learning algorithms, and interactive dashboards for data exploration and insights generation.

8. Cybersecurity Tool:Design a cybersecurity tool for threat detection, vulnerability assessment, or network monitoring. Develop features for scanning, analyzing, and mitigating security risks in computer networks, web applications, or mobile devices.

9. Augmented Reality (AR) or Virtual Reality (VR) Application:Create an AR or VR application for immersive experiences in gaming, education, training, virtual tours, or marketing. Use tools and libraries like Unity, Unreal Engine, or ARCore/ARKit to develop interactive and engaging experiences.

10. Mobile App for Social Impact:Develop a mobile app that addresses social issues such as mental health awareness, environmental conservation, community engagement, or access to essential services. Collaborate with non-profit organizations or community groups to identify needs and design impactful solutions.

Remember to choose a project that aligns with your interests, skills, and career goals. Consider collaborating with classmates or industry partners to enhance the scope and impact of your project. Additionally, document your project thoroughly and consider publishing your findings or presenting your work at conferences to showcase your achievements to potential employers or graduate programs.

What are the benefits of using a VPN at home? Is there a risk of privacy invasion when using a VPN?

Using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) at home offers several benefits, but it’s essential to be aware of potential privacy risks as well. Let’s explore both aspects:

Benefits of Using a VPN at Home

1. Enhanced Privacy and Security: A VPN encrypts your internet connection, ensuring that your online activities remain private and secure from hackers, ISPs (Internet Service Providers), and other third parties. This is particularly important when using public Wi-Fi networks, where your data is vulnerable to interception.

2. Bypassing Geo-Restrictions: VPNs allow you to bypass geo-restrictions and access content that may be blocked in your region. By connecting to servers located in other countries, you can access streaming services, websites, and online content that may not be available in your location.

3. Anonymous Browsing: VPNs mask your IP address and location, making it difficult for websites and online services to track your browsing activities. This helps protect your anonymity and prevents advertisers from targeting you based on your online behavior.

4. Preventing Bandwidth Throttling: Some ISPs engage in bandwidth throttling, where they intentionally slow down your internet connection for certain activities such as streaming or torrenting. Using a VPN can help bypass throttling and maintain consistent internet speeds.

5. Secure Remote Access:If you work remotely or need to access your home network while traveling, a VPN allows you to securely connect to your home network from anywhere in the world. This ensures that your data remains encrypted and protected, even when accessing it from public networks.

Risks of Using a VPN

1. Trustworthiness of VPN Providers:Not all VPN providers are trustworthy, and some may log your browsing activities or sell your data to third parties. It’s essential to choose a reputable VPN provider with a strong privacy policy and a commitment to user security.

2. Potential for DNS Leaks: In some cases, VPNs may leak your DNS (Domain Name System) queries, revealing your browsing activities to your ISP. This can compromise your privacy, especially if you’re using a VPN for sensitive activities.

3. False Sense of Security:While VPNs provide encryption and privacy benefits, they are not foolproof. It’s essential to practice good cybersecurity hygiene, such as using strong passwords, keeping your software updated, and avoiding suspicious websites and downloads, even when using a VPN.

4. Legal Implications: In some countries, the use of VPNs may be restricted or illegal. It’s important to familiarize yourself with the laws and regulations regarding VPN usage in your country to avoid potential legal consequences.

In conclusion, using a VPN at home can offer significant privacy and security benefits, but it’s essential to choose a reputable provider and be aware of potential risks. By understanding how VPNs work and taking appropriate precautions, you can enjoy a safer and more private online experience.

Leveraging ICT Integration for Business Growth

In today’s rapidly evolving digital landscape, Information and Communication Technology (ICT) integration has become an indispensable component for businesses aiming to stay competitive and thrive in the marketplace. From streamlining operations to enhancing customer experiences, ICT offers a myriad of opportunities for businesses across all sectors. In this comprehensive guide, we’ll delve into the various ways businesses can leverage ICT integration to drive growth, efficiency, and innovation.

1. Enhancing Operational Efficiency

One of the primary benefits of ICT integration is its ability to streamline and automate business processes. Whether it’s inventory management, supply chain logistics, or internal communication systems, ICT solutions such as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ems,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software, and collaboration tools empower businesses to optimize efficiency, reduce manual errors, and enhance productivity. By digitizing and centralizing data, businesses can make informed decisions faster and allocate resources more effectively.

2. Improving Customer Engagement

In today’s digital age, customer expectations are higher than ever. ICT integration enables businesses to deliver personalized and seamless experiences across multiple touchpoints, fostering stronger customer relationships and loyalty. Through omnichannel marketing strategies, businesses can engage customers through various channels such as websites, social media, mobile apps, and email marketing, creating cohesive and consistent brand experiences. Furthermore, data analytics tools enable businesses to gain valuable insights into customer behavior and preferences, allowing for targeted marketing campaigns and product offerings tailored to individual needs.

3. Facilitating Remote Work and Collaboration

The emergence of remote work trends has accelerated the adoption of ICT tools for collaboration and communication. Cloud-based platforms, video conferencing software, project management tools, and virtual workspace solutions enable teams to collaborate effectively irrespective of geographical boundaries. ICT integration not only enhances productivity by facilitating seamless communication and collaboration but also offers flexibility and work-life balance for employees. Businesses that embrace remote work models can tap into a global talent pool, reduce overhead costs, and maintain operations in times of crisis or disruptions.

4. Driving Innovation and Adaptability

ICT integration empowers businesses to innovate and adapt to changing market dynamics swiftly. Through technologies such as Artificial Intelligence (AI), Internet of Things (IoT), Big Data analytics, and blockchain, businesses can unlock new opportunities, optimize processes, and create disruptive business models. Whether it’s predictive analytics for forecasting demand, IoT sensors for real-time monitoring of assets, or AI-powered chatbots for customer support, ICT enables businesses to stay ahead of the curve and respond proactively to emerging trends and customer needs.

5. Ensuring Data Security and Compliance

With the increasing digitization of business operations and the growing volume of sensitive data, cybersecurity and data privacy have become paramount concerns for businesses. ICT integration involves implementing robust cybersecurity measures, encryption protocols, access controls, and compliance frameworks to safeguard data against cyber threats and regulatory requirements. By investing in cybersecurity infrastructure and employee training, businesses can build trust with customers, protect their reputation, and mitigate the risk of data breaches and compliance violations.

In conclusion, ICT integration is not merely a technological upgrade but a strategic imperative for businesses seeking to thrive in the digital age. By harnessing the power of ICT solutions, businesses can drive operational efficiency, enhance customer experiences, foster collaboration, stimulate innovation, and ensure data security and compliance. Embracing ICT integration enables businesses to adapt to the evolving landscape, seize new opportunities, and position themselves for sustained growth and success in an increasingly competitive marketplace.
